Shut off valve installation services involve fitting a valve into a property's water supply line to control the flow of water throughout the home or building. This process typically includes assessing the existing plumbing system, selecting the appropriate type of shut off valve, and securely installing it in a location that allows for easy access in case of emergencies or maintenance. Proper installation ensures that homeowners can quickly stop water flow if a leak or burst pipe occurs, helping to minimize water damage and reduce repair costs.

These services are essential for addressing common plumbing problems such as burst pipes, persistent leaks, or sudden water surges. When a pipe bursts or a leak develops, having a shut off valve in place allows homeowners to isolate the problem area immediately, preventing water from flooding the property. Additionally, shut off valves are useful during plumbing repairs or fixture replacements, providing a convenient way to turn off water supply without disrupting the entire household or building.

Properties that typically utilize shut off valve installation include single-family homes, multi-unit residential buildings, commercial properties, and even some industrial facilities. Homes in areas prone to freezing temperatures often benefit from having accessible shut off valves to prevent extensive water damage during winter storms. Commercial buildings with complex plumbing systems also rely on these valves to manage water flow efficiently and respond quickly to plumbing emergencies, ensuring minimal disruption to operations.

The overview below groups typical Shut Off Valve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bellevue,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For minor shut off valve repairs or replacements, local contractors typically charge between $150 and $400.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ward fixes on existing valves.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ire shut off valve usually costs between $250 and $600, depending on the type of valve and complexity of access. Larger or more involved projects can reach $1,000 or more in some cases.

Complex Installations - Installing shut off valves as part of a larger plumbing upgrade or in hard-to-reach areas may range from $600 to $1,500. These projects are less common but necessary for extensive plumbing work.

Emergency or Unforeseen Work - Urgent repairs or unexpected complications can push costs into the $1,000-$2,500 range. Such projects are less frequent but may be required in emergency situations or for significant repairs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a shut off valve and why is it important? A shut off valve controls the flow of water in a plumbing system, allowing for quick isolation of sections during repairs or emergencies.

Where can I get a shut off valve installed? Local contractors in Bellevue, WA, and nearby areas can handle shut off valve installation services for residential and commercial properties.

How do I know if my existing shut off valve needs to be replaced? Signs such as leaks, difficulty turning the valve, or corrosion may indicate that a replacement is necessary, and a professional can assess the condition.

Can a shut off valve be installed in any plumbing system? Most plumbing systems can accommodate a shut off valve, but a local service provider can determine the best type and placement for specific setups.

What types of shut off valves are available? Common options include ball valves, gate valves, and globe valves, with a local contractor able to recommend the most suitable choice for your needs.
